A non-destructive method of collecting samples for DNA analysis of the Chinese giant salamander is described and validated. DNA was extracted from the skin secretion and shedding using a Chelex-based method, and partial 12S rRNA gene sequences were amplified and sequenced. Chelates can inhibit the iron- and copper-catalyzed autoxidation of ascorbate at pH 7.0. Diethylenetriaminepentaacetic acid (DTPA or DETAPAC) and Desferal (deferoximane mesylate) slow the iron-catalyzed oxidation of ascorbate as effectively as reducing the trace levels of contaminating iron in buffers with Chelex resin. AIM To determine allele frequencies' distribution for 15 short tandem repeat (STR) loci in a population sample of 1910 unrelated individuals from the region of Wallachia, South Romania. METHODS DNA was isolated using Chelex 100 method and an adapted version of AGOWA mag DNA Isolation Kit Sputum.
